Transaction 2b9957280757732b36bde111199b4abbf8046367a693ff83189a3ad485614853

1 Input
2 Outputs
  • 2b9957280757732b36bde111199b4abbf8046367a693ff83189a3ad485614853:0
  • value  1878143
    address  38qDTgeVqjRi14ptz4Xfee2wf7BUNouLvA
  • 2b9957280757732b36bde111199b4abbf8046367a693ff83189a3ad485614853:1
  • value  42878149
    address  3NBa5DNGuhQWcBnzQrvaisarxMJKoFDn8X